Building strong relationships on the golf course

A well-maintained golf course isn't just the result of expert greenkeeping – it also relies on strong communication and collaboration between greenkeepers, golf club staff and players. When these groups work together, courses thrive and the golfing experience improves for everyone. This page highlights stories of successful teamwork, showcasing how clear communication, mutual respect and shared understanding enhance course conditions and club operations. From explaining maintenance practices to golfers to fostering positive relationships between staff, discover how strong connections contribute to better golf, smoother operations and a more enjoable experience for all who love the game.
